When does the mitotic spindle attach to the kinetichore?

Respuesta :

firebug05
firebug05 firebug05
  • 13-10-2020

Answer:

The Prometaphase.

Explanation:

Typically in biology the prometaphase is overlooked. It is between the prophase and the metaphase, and is the exact point in which the mitotic spindles attach to the kinetochores. Metaphase, which occurs directly afterwards, is when the chromosomes are lined up to be split and pulled towards opposite sides of the cell.
